diff --git a/dlls/quartz/enumregfilters.c b/dlls/quartz/enumregfilters.c index f8d7820d511..93e4d61c81a 100644 --- a/dlls/quartz/enumregfilters.c +++ b/dlls/quartz/enumregfilters.c @@ -131,6 +131,13 @@ static ULONG WINAPI IEnumRegFiltersImpl_Release(IEnumRegFilters * iface) if (!refCount) { + ULONG i; + + for(i = 0; i < This->size; i++) + { + CoTaskMemFree(This->RegFilters[i].Name); + } + CoTaskMemFree(This->RegFilters); CoTaskMemFree(This); return 0; } else